Nassourdine Imavov says his next UFC assignment is supposed to be a middleweight title fight, not another stay-busy booking.
Nassourdine Imavov says the UFC only want him fighting for the middleweight title vs. Sean Strickland next.
“I wanted to fight Dricus to stay active, and the UFC told me I could only fight for the belt. After Khamzat vs. Strickland, I’m 100% fighting for the belt.”
Nassourdine Imavov reveals his next fight will be for the UFC middleweight title.

Imavov Points Toward Strickland
Imavov and Strickland already have history. Strickland beat him by unanimous decision in January 2023, when the bout was contested at light heavyweight after late changes to the booking.
Since then, the middleweight picture has been rebuilt several times. Strickland’s title run has already shaped recent MiddleEasy coverage, including his post-fight belt moment after UFC 328 and the aftermath of his win over Khamzat Chimaev.
Imavov has also kept himself near the front of the division. His run includes a major win over Israel Adesanya, and that result still helps explain why he is talking like a title challenger rather than another contender in line.
Dricus Du Plessis Stays In The Background
The Dricus piece matters because Imavov framed the situation as a choice between staying active and waiting for the belt. If the UFC really told him to wait, the promotion may already see him as the next clean title challenger once the Strickland picture settles.
Du Plessis has remained busy in the headlines after his recent work against Kamaru Usman, including debate around Usman’s foul complaints after UFC Oklahoma City. Imavov saying he wanted that fight first adds another layer to the division’s traffic.
For now, the firm part is Imavov’s public claim: he says the UFC told him the belt is the only fight available. Until the promotion announces the matchup, that leaves the division with one more contender loudly staking his place in line.
